"It's beautiful."

Ruto sighed in ecstasy. The sun was slowly setting on the horizon just beyond Zora's domain, painting the sky in dazzling hues of red, orange, and purple. On top of a cliff stood Link and his fiancée. She clung lovingly to his arm.

"Link?" Ruto gazed up at her beloved, who was staring at the sunset, his face still and serious, "You've been so quiet. It was nice of you to take me here. We don't get to spend as much time together as I'd like."

Link closed his eyes and sighed.

"Ruto…" He said, "I… I have something to tell you."

"What is it?"

"I-I've wanted to tell you this for a long time…."

Ruto blushed, "Yes?"

He looked into her eyes; "It's about our wedding."

The Zora's heart skipped a beat, "Have you finally picked a date!"

Link took a deep breath and closed his eyes. He laid his hands upon her shoulders.

"Years back… when you gave me the Zora's Sapphire… I-I was a naïve young boy, I had no idea what marriage was or what a fiancée was, and I just took the stone thinking you were babbling about nothing… But I'm older now, and I understand…" He turned away from Ruto, "Ruto… I don't… no… I… can't marry you."

Ruto's fins drooped visibly, "W-what?"

"I'm sorry… I don't want to hurt you, but it was all one big mistake…."

She tried to look at his face, "But… Link…."

He avoided her gaze.

"I'm sorry." Link whispered.

The Zora sank to her knees, dumbfounded. Tears welled up in her eyes. She looked up desperately at his slender frame.

"But-but I love you."

Link walked away.

"Link!"

Tears broke free of their restraints. Ruto rubbed her arms. The sun had set; it was beginning to get chilly. Then, her shoulders shaking, she doubled over and cried.
